Alan Wake’s American Nightmare Scares Its Way To Steam


Posted on May 20, 2012 by Rae Michelle Richards

Alan Wake’s American Nightmare, Remedy Entertainment’s long awaited semi-sequel to 2009’s Alan Wake was released on the Xbox Live Arcade this past February. It looks like Alan’s nightmares are far from over as American Nightmare is set to wreak havoc on Windows PC tomorrow through Steam for $14.99.

The game features a single player campaign as well as the arcade like “Fight Til Dawn Mode” which tasks players with fighting hordes of enemies until the sun rises. The great thing about Fight Til Dawn is that it can be played co-operatively online with other players. You don’t have to face the darkness alone!

Jax Brings In Nearly Half A Million Dollars


Posted on May 19, 2012 by Andrew Minott

To update you on a previous story, Riot Games has announced that at the completion of their fundraiser on Friday, over $480,000 came in due to the participation of over 140,000 contributors, “100 percent of which will go to Make-A-Wish America and Make-A-Wish International in Joe’s name.”

This fundraising plan by Riot mirrors one they ran a year ago to benefit the earthquake and tsunami relief efforts in Japan, where over 50,000 League of Legends players helped raise over $160,000 for the Red Cross.

MechWarrior Tactics Beta Imminent


Posted on May 19, 2012 by Andrew Minott

We’ve already told you about one MechWarrior game coming out this year. Did you know there was another?

Being developed for a 2012 PC release by Roadhouse Interactive and ACRONYM Games, MechWarrior Tactics has a top-down battlefield perspective, and has players controlling squads of ‘Mechs (in contrast to MechWarrior Online, in which you control a single bipedal tank from a first-person perspective). And, according to an email sent out a couple days ago, you can acquire a closed beta key by subscribing to their temporary forum site right now.

Worms Revolution Confirmed For E3


Posted on May 18, 2012 by Rae Michelle Richards

Team 17’s next Worms title, Worms Revolution, will be shown at this year’s E3 the developer confirmed today. Revolution will also bring some major upgrades in terms of physics with new hazards and dynamic water physics.

This means that water won’t just appear as a death trap at the bottom of the map during matches. Instead, there may be pools of water located within the map. Say you destroy the terrain surrounding it, the water will flood deforming the terrain. New types of obstacles include clouds of toxic gas and new ways to cause fiery destruction.

Worms Revolution will be released during the 3rd quarter of 2012 on Windows PC and unannounced consoles.

Dust 514 Beta Registration Begins


Posted on May 18, 2012 by Daniel Shannon

CCP has announced that you can now register for the DUST 514 beta. DUST is a PS3 exclusive, free to play, MMO FPS that is connected to CCP’s EVE Online universe. In DUST, players can act as mercenaries for EVE players, and the outcome of DUST battles could result in the conquest of planets for EVE’s numerous player run corporations and alliances. Hitler’s Dog to play a major role in Iron Front


Posted on May 18, 2012 by Daniel Shannon

Deep Silver has just announced a novel multiplayer mode for X1 Software/AWAR’s upcoming WW2 tactical shooter Iron Front: Liberation 1944. The new mode, named “Assassinate the Blondie,” tasks two Soviet players with the job of killing Blondi, Hitler’s ever loyal German Shepherd. Two German players will naturally have to protect their Führer’s beloved pet. Doubtlessly, Blondi’s premature death would demoralize Hitler, and the repercussions would negatively affect the German war effort.

It is unclear right now what Blondi will be doing. Will one of Hitler’s confidants be walking Blondi? Will Blondi be unleashed and aimlessly wandering about the map? Will someone be able to play as Blondi? As a fan of the Escort/Assassination mode from Team Fortress Classic, I’m hoping that the later is the case. Rayman Origins 3DS Demo Now Available


Posted on May 17, 2012 by Rae Michelle Richards

Have you been looking for a mobile platforming fix? Ubisoft has released a demo version of Rayman Origins on the 3DS E-Shop. This demo doesn’t skimp on the content either, offering prospective owners 3 full levels from the final game including Swinging Caves, Playing in the Shade and Shooting Me Softly.

The console version of Origins was a critical success and regarded as one of the best Rayman games to date. The 3DS version expands upon what made last year’s console release so great with Street Pass functionality and in game collectables.

The full version of Rayman Origins for the Nintendo 3DS will be released on June 5th at a suggested price of $29.99.

Solid Snake Infiltrates Vita On June 12th


Posted on May 17, 2012 by Rae Michelle Richards

We already knew that the Metal Gear Solid Collection would be making the jump to Vita next month but now we have a more specific window. Solid Snake will make his debut on Sony’s next generation portable on June 15th according to Konami.

The Vita version of Metal Gear Solid Collection will differ slightly from its console counterparts. For one it only includes Metal Gear Solid 2 and Metal Gear Solid 3 since Peace Walker can be purchased digital through the PSN already.  Konami has also implemented some touch based controls in both games, giving you the ability to zoom with a sniper rifle or peak around corners, for example.

Sins of a Solar Empire: Rebellion Beta Updated


Posted on May 17, 2012 by Daniel Shannon

The preorder beta for Sins of a Solar Empire: Rebellion, the upcoming stand alone expansion to the Sins of a Solar Empire series, has just been updated to its third version. The main addition is the inclusion of the Vasari, the sole non-human faction in the original Sins of a Solar Empire.

Of course, it isn’t exactly a surprise that the Vasari are in Rebellion, but their presence is welcome. Without them, Sins would be about humans killing humans over whether religion or the free market should rule space. This is a false dichotomy. The Vasari should rule space.
